Ask about an early time travel horror film from Hong Kong?

Ask about an early time travel horror film from Hong Kong?

2024-09-17 08:20
When he was young, he had read a story about a Taoist master and disciple and a vampire. Most of the content was already blurry, and he could only remember the last part. The Taoist master and the vampire traveled back to the 1990s, and the heroine became a modern workplace woman. The vampire turned into a rich boy (handsome guy), and the Taoist master and disciple turned into a wolfhound, and they specially protected the female lead. There was a scene where a handsome vampire proposed to the female protagonist, but the female protagonist refused. Then, the vampire took out a knife and sang (quite sad) while stabbing his right leg. After a while, he revealed his original form and became a vampire. The Taoist master and disciple who had turned into a wolfhound also turned back into their human forms. However, for some reason, they had lost their magic power. One of the cameras was sandwiched between two minivans. Because they had lost their magic power, they could not push it away or break free. In the end, it seemed that the Taoist master and his disciples had perished together with the vampire in the 1990s. Before the Taoist master and his disciples died, they told the female protagonist that they had transmigrated from ancient times to protect the female protagonist. Does anyone know what movie it is?
